Houston, We Have a Crush
Online

After finding a phone accidentally left behind by an astronaut, a lonely alien develops an all-consuming crush that tests his hold on reality.

Director

Omer Ben Shachar
Omer Ben-Shachar is an award-winning writer-director. His films have earned honors like a Student Academy Award, Webby Award, multiple Vimeo Staff Picks, and top prizes at UrbanWorld, Palm Springs and Atlanta. Omer is a participant in Film Independent’s Project Involve & Screenwriting Lab, Warner Bros.’ and Paramount’s directing programs, and an AFI directing graduate.

Our special effects team, Symbolic Arts, were invaluable. They not only created Ditto from a sketch to a fully formed animatronic creature, but also expertly puppeteered it on set. Alongside Sam Humphrey, our talented actor who brought Ditto to life, they created a character that, despite being a puppet, has a huge heart and soul.
